Transaction fb23ece82116fa5e43b21a2ec384b9e04a675cbba3f46510ffeecdbd3a658ce9
1 Input
1 Output
-
fb23ece82116fa5e43b21a2ec384b9e04a675cbba3f46510ffeecdbd3a658ce9:0
- value
- 12272597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d9bcd7c942d07e368d40a542936be2369b4db62 OP_EQUAL
- address
- 3LSB6EF3NDPKrrpL1AxveKuF7Kd9UJWpaH